3. Best Gig Ever

It’s hard to say which individual show has been our best over the years. We try our guts out every night onstage to put on the best show we possibly can. We leave everything up there – blood, sweat and tears. Saying that, we’ve had some great nights playing at Cherry Bar and Frankie’s. We’ve been lucky enough to have shared the stage with some great bands such as Dallas Crane, Cosmic Psychos and The Casanovas, which were all classic nights. As for worst gig, we were once asked to play at a certain hotel in central rural Victoria that’ll remain nameless. We went onstage, looked out and saw all of three people in a room that could hold 200. We then began to play. One-and-a-half songs and the publican pulled the plug, screaming the band is too loud and that the gig was over. This resulted in some choice words coming from the stage, almost an exchange of blows and us leaving with my car being bloody graffitied!

4. Current Playlist

We listen to a pretty eclectic mix. There are the standards that always get a run, stuff like AC/DC, Rose Tattoo, The Angels and Slade. We do listen to a lot of stuff that people probably wouldn’t associate us with. We are big fans of the great songwriters, people like Bob Dylan, Warren Zevon and Elton John. We mix it up a lot. There is always heaps of blues and soul getting spun at home.
